About this property

Amazing Location, 2700 sqft, 5-bedroom, Family-friendly, 1 Mile from DC

We'll be away visiting family over the summer, and we'd love for you to stay in our home while we're gone!

Our 2700 square-foot home is right in the heart of Hyattsville's Historic District, a charming, bustling, highly walkable, family-friendly gem just one mile from DC. Our home is within one block of two playgrounds, half a block from our beloved coffee shop, two blocks from the local brewery/restaurant, and a quick walk to a slew of restaurants and shops. 10-foot ceilings through much of the house give a spacious feel, and the five bedrooms (plus a big playroom with lots of beautiful toys!) make it an ideal spot for family gatherings.

Our home boasts five bedrooms and three full bathrooms. The master bedroom has a queen bed and bay windows. The second bedroom, where three of our kids sleep, has bunk beds and a toddler bed. The third, which doubles as a nursery, has a queen bed, a crib, and a changing table. The fourth, which is also upstairs, has a daybed which pulls out to king size, and it also has a desk and some bookshelves. The fifth bedroom is down on the main floor and is outfitted with a queen bed.

The first bedroom is attached to the master bedroom. It has a toilet, a shower, and a tub. The second bathroom, also upstairs, also has a toilet, a shower, and a tub. The third bathroom, which is down on the main floor, has a toilet and a shower.

In addition to the bedrooms and bathrooms, there is a spacious living room (PLEASE NOTE: There is NO TV in the house! We do, however, have a projector and projector screen which you'd be very welcome to set up!). There's a dining room with a big wooden table and a kitchen which was fully renovated in 2020. Off the kitchen, there's a big playroom with lots of beautiful toys. There's also a small office with a small desk on the main floor. Finally, down in the basement, there's a washer and a dryer, so you're welcome to do laundry during your stay. There's also a stationary bike and a kettle bell down there.

The whole house has central air and heating, and there's WIFI throughout. There's a fenced-in backyard with two playhouses, a fire pit (bring your own wood!), a table, and chairs.

PLEASE NOTE BEFORE BOOKING: The whole of the main floor and upstairs will be yours during your stay. HOWEVER, we have two permanent tenants who live in the basement. The door from the basement upstairs, however, locks on your side, and they do not have access to your space. Indeed, you will likely never run into them, except possibly in the backyard or if you happen to be doing laundry at the same time. They are, however, lovely (they're both graduate students, named Michael and Robert, and are very quiet and polite). They have been downstairs through many a rental, and there's never been any issues whatsoever: again, the vast majority of renters never know they're down there, and the ones who bump into them have a pleasant interaction or two in the laundry room, and that's it. If you have any questions about them, though, please feel free to contact us!

ALSO PLEASE NOTE: The photos on this listing all give a sense for the space, but because this is our home, many of the details change from time to time: as kids get older, as items suffer from wear and tear, and as the Thrift Store Gods smile upon us and bestow on us treasures we couldn't possibly refuse, some of the furniture and other items get swapped out or rearranged. So don't be surprised if some of the details aren't exactly as they are in the photos--but, again, the basics are all accurately represented!
